Transaction cc5a25a710e7777d87be308a9c26f805632835a43355e57bbdc7ea34a8f6cdf3
1 Input
1 Output
-
cc5a25a710e7777d87be308a9c26f805632835a43355e57bbdc7ea34a8f6cdf3:0
- value
- 581136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a3a670a578a1f2f83fd30025978e13315fe3e62 OP_EQUAL
- address
- 3CqJKpkENj5WpBHAG9tbGNuEHdrFKphX7y